Ringies wont sit tight until around the third egg, (depending on how many will be laid)

Last year my Green pair had 2 clutches of 5 eggs each clutch and didn't start sitting until the third egg.
This year she has laid 3 and is sitting tight.....looks like 3 is the magic number for this year. :)

The Lutino hen started sitting on number 3 egg as well. She has 4 and shouldn't be too long before they hatch! :D :D :D :D :D :D

So I wouldn't worry too much at this stage. :)
